The Aircraft and Spacecraft sector in Germany employed 90.93 thousand persons in 2023. Historical analysis shows a fluctuating trend with a significant dip in 2016, followed by steady growth reaching 2023. The year-on-year employment increased consistently over the past two years at modest rates (1.22% in 2022 and 1.19% in 2023). The forecast indicates a continued upward trajectory, with the CAGR expected to stabilize around 0.89% from 2024 to 2028.
